Publisher's Summary

What if what you really need is right there in front of you, if you just take a moment to look up?

Milly has been waiting for this moment forever, and finally it’s just an hour away - an interview with Vogue magazine and the opportunity to get her Louboutin-clad foot in the door. There’s just one problem - totally engrossed in her mobile phone, Milly doesn’t see the bus that is fast approaching - until it’s too late....

When Milly next opens her eyes, the consequences of her accident become clear. Everything she has worked for and dreamed of suddenly feels out of reach. But there is one bright spot on her horizon - the reappearance of her ex Jed, in all of his six-foot-four, broad-shouldered glory, with the most piercing ice blue eyes Milly ever saw.

Once used to working in a whirlwind, Milly now has the chance to reconsider how to live. Will she rush back to the treadmill, get her head down and back to business, or is there a whole other life waiting for her, if she’ll just look up to see it?

Maxine Morrey’s latest uplifting, heart-warming romance is guaranteed to brighten up your day.

Painful

I gave this book the benefit of the doubt in the beginning, then came to a point where I was too far invested not to keep going, then I got bored and skipped 1/3 of the book just to find out what happened at the end. Even with skipping a good chunk of it, I didn’t feel I missed anything in the mediocre story line and was disappointed all the same at the end.
